Notice Description

To develop an approach to modelling the health impacts of economic policies in a Welsh context. For example:- Modelling the fiscal and private returns on investment from improved health due to increased employment (ideally in good, fair work) and changes in tax and benefit policies and uptake of benefits.- Modelling the impacts of policies implemented elsewhere in the UK that might be replicated in Wales, e.g. Scottish Child Payment;- Modelling the impacts of policies in non-devolved areas which have an impact in Wales, such as the winter fuel payments cap;- Modelling the impacts of progressive policies in relation to community wealth building, improving housing conditions, improving gender equity etc.The requirement is to support the creation of architecture for an economic policy model with health outcomes, and support for the Economics & Value team to make use of it.NOTE: The authority is using eTenderwales to carry out this procurement process. The Open Contracting Data Standard (OCDS) is a framework designed to increase transparency and access to public procurement data in the public sector. It is widely used by governments and organisations worldwide to report on procurement processes and contracts.
